The Akruti Image 08 (and similar versions like Akruti 12) is a specialized font used primarily for creating decorative borders and artistic graphics within Microsoft Word and other DTP software. Key Features
Symbol-Based Graphics: Unlike standard text fonts, Akruti Image fonts map specific keyboard keys to decorative symbols, corner designs, and intricate line borders.
Custom Page Borders: It is widely used to create professional and ethnic-style page borders in MS Word that aren't available in the default "Page Border" menu. 08 akruti image font for ms word download
Multi-Platform Compatibility: Works across various Windows versions (XP through Windows 11) and can be used in applications like Word, Excel, PageMaker, and Photoshop.
Scalability: As a TrueType Font (TTF), it maintains high quality and sharpness at any size, making it suitable for large-format printing. How to Download and Use in MS Word
While specific versions may be part of larger paid packages like Akruti Next or Akruti Vistaar, you can generally install them using these steps:
Download: Obtain the .ttf font file from an authorized source like Akruti Products.
Install: Right-click the downloaded font file and select Install. Apply in Word: Open MS Word and go to the Font selection dropdown. Type or select "12Akruti Image" or "08Akruti Image".
Type letters on your keyboard (A, B, C, etc.) to reveal different border segments and symbols.
Pro-Tip: To create a full border, use a Text Box or Table and type the decorative characters inside, then adjust the font size until they form a continuous frame.

To use 08 Akruti Image or similar Akruti fonts in Microsoft Word, you must download the font files and install them directly into your Windows operating system. Once installed system-wide, these fonts automatically become available in the Word font dropdown menu. 1. Locate and Download the Font
Search for the Font: Use a browser to find reputable font repositories. While "08 Akruti Image" is a specific legacy font, it is often part of larger Akruti font bundles like Akruti Classic Fonts or Akruti Office.
Download the File: Most fonts download as a .zip file or directly as a .ttf (TrueType) or .otf (OpenType) file.
Unzip the Folder: If the font is in a .zip archive, right-click it and select Extract All to access the actual font files. 2. Install the Font on Windows
There are two main ways to install the font so MS Word can recognize it: Right-Click Method: Go to your downloads folder. Right-click the .ttf or .otf file. Select Install (or "Install for all users"). Font Previewer Method: Double-click the font file to open a preview window. Click the Install button at the top of the window. 3.
